Minutes — Management Meeting, Ardenvale Logistics

Present: executive team; prepared for the board. Agenda: joint venture proposal with Skarne Freight of Lowmarsh. Discussed capital split (60/40), shared depot usage, and branding under the Northreach name. Legal flagged exclusivity terms needing revision. Finance confirmed funding capacity without new debt. Vote scheduled for next session. Further strategic context appears in the confidential note below.

board note of fahog-bawep: The renewal with Holixax Holdings closes at $20 million a year, 20 percent below the last contract. Project Druwyn slips by two quarters because of the supplier delay.

Ticket: Crashfall ingest failing on staging

New folks, please read carefully. The Pebblekit mobile app's crash reports aren't reaching the symbolication queue because staging's env file was copied without its upload credential. Symptoms: 401s in the collector logs every five minutes. To fix, add the missing line to the env file, exactly as follows.

secret setting of fafop-tagep: VAULT_KEY29=6a815d21e2d77cc25ef1802d73ee6

Minutes — Management Meeting, Orvale Plant Capacity. Quick one: demand for the Stratlin range keeps outpacing the Orvale line, so we've agreed to add a second shift rather than build out now. Sales leads should keep quoting current lead times until further notice. The longer-term capacity thinking is in the confidential note below.

management briefing: Project Ulavan slips by two quarters because of the staffing delay.

**Vendor note: Inkmill markdown pipeline**

Rendering for Parchway docs is outsourced to Inkmill under an annual contract, renewing each March. They handle sanitization and PDF export; we own the upload queue. SLA: 4-hour response on rendering failures. Escalate only after two failed retries. Their support desk is reachable at the address below.

billing contact of hahaf-baguf = zorael.tammir.jorius@sivrelhq.internal